IGNACIO (NACHO) RAMOS, SR. On December 20, 2011, a tremendous loss was suffered with the passing of a son, father, grandfather, brother, uncle and friend, as our heavenly father called home Ignacio (Nacho) Ramos, Sr., 65. He was born on August 23, 1946 and was raised in El Paso, Texas and served in the United States Navy and was a Vietnam War, Veteran. His passion for life and captivating laughter will be missed by all. Our hearts are broken; however, our peace comes in knowing he is with our heavenly Father. Ignacio Ramos, Sr. was preceded in death by his beloved father, Feliciano Ramos. He is survived by his mother, Carolina Ramos; sons: Ignacio (Monica) Ramos Jr., Hector Israel (Angie) Ramos, Felix Ramos and five grandchildren: Aaron Giovanni, Ryan Alexander, Jacob Michael, Christian Robert and Crista Angie Ramos; brother, George (Carolyn) Ramos; sisters: Estella (Adan) Lopez, Carolina (Joe) Gonzalez, Esperanza (Albert) Gamboa, Alicia (Daniel) Barrientes, Gloria (David) Olsen and many nieces and nephews. Pallbearers: Aaron Ramos, Arthur Ramos, Robert Ramos, Adan Lopez, David Lopez, Darrin Lopez, Albert Gamboa III, Javier Colmenero. Visitation will be held from 5 p.m. to 9 p.m., Rosary at 7 p.m. at Sunset Funeral Home 4631 Hondo Pass, El Paso, Texas Monday, December 26, 2011. Funeral Mass will be at 9:45 a.m., Tuesday, December 27, 2011 at Our Lady of Guadalupe Church 2709 Alabama St. Burial to follow at Ft Bliss National Cemetery with Military Honors.
